Your pool equipment must comply with the standards set by the National Electric Code (NEC) and other governing authorities such as your City and County. Proper installation helps ensure your swimming pool equipment operates safely, efficiently, and reliably for years to come.
Incorrect wiring or improper setup can create serious safety risks and lead to premature failure of pool pumps, pool motors, pool automation and other pool equipment. To protect your pool and your investment, every professional installation should include:
GFCI protection and proper bonding for pool pumps, lights, automation and other equipment
Correct wire sizing based on pump voltage and distance from the breaker panel
A dedicated breaker for pool equipment — never shared circuits or extension cords
Just as important as the equipment itself is the professional installing it. Pool electrical systems require specialized knowledge. Working with an experienced, licensed and insured pool contractor helps ensure voltage requirements, grounding, bonding, and all electrical components are designed and installed correctly from the start.
